First homes go on sale at new Cardiff development

Paul Oakley at Longwood Grange

Bellway has successfully launched its Longwood Grange development to the public in Lisvane.

The housebuilder opened a sales office at the site in September, where the first properties were released onto the market for purchase. More than five homes have already been sold since the development opened.

Construction work is underway at the development, off Maerdy Lane, which is part of a wider new neighbourhood being created at the northern edge of Cardiff.

Longwood Grange will comprise 270 new homes, including 216 properties for private sale and 54 affordable homes for local people.

Longwood Grange will form part of the wider 1,000-home Churchlands development which is taking shape on land between Lisvane and Pontprennau.

The 216 private homes Bellway is delivering at the site will comprise a range of two, three, four and five-bedroom houses. The homes for affordable rent and shared ownership will feature a mix of one and two-bedroom apartments and two and three-bedroom houses.

The housebuilder is set to open three showhomes at the development towards the end of the year.
